Cisco warns of large-scale attacks against VPN, SSH services
The “brute force” campaign detected in March attacks security equipment by Cisco, CheckPoint and others with a barrage of usernames and passwords until the correct combinations are found and systems compromised. Read more @ bleepingcomputer.com
